Latest Patents

Sakashita's latest inventions include a groundbreaking method for the continuous manufacturing of polycarbonate. This method addresses common production challenges, specifically pipe clogging and foreign material admixture during the transesterification process from a dihydroxy compound and a carbonic diester. By controlling the temperature of the reactor equipment in contact with the polycarbonate lower polycondensate, he significantly improves the efficiency and quality of polycarbonate production.
